Nova turma com conversação 5x por semana 🔥

Nova turma com conversação 5x por semana 🔥




Primeiros Passos para Dominar Loops em Python

Primeiros Passos para Dominar Loops em Python

Introdução

Python é uma linguagem de programação versátil e poderosa que oferece diversas funcionalidades para os desenvolvedores. Entre essas funcionalidades, os loops são fundamentais para a criação de algoritmos eficientes e soluções robustas. Neste artigo, vamos explorar os primeiros passos para dominar loops em Python e como eles podem elevar suas habilidades de programação.

Tipos de Loops em Python

Loop While

Um loop em Python é uma estrutura que permite repetir um bloco de código várias vezes. Existem dois tipos principais de loops em Python: o loop while e o loop for. O loop while executa um bloco de código repetidamente enquanto uma determinada condição for verdadeira. Por outro lado, o loop for é utilizado para iterar sobre uma sequência de elementos, como uma lista ou uma string.

Loop For

Para começar a dominar loops em Python, é importante entender a sintaxe básica dessas estruturas. Vamos dar uma olhada em alguns exemplos simples para ilustrar como os loops funcionam:

Exemplo 1 (Loop while):

contador = 0
while contador < 5:
    print("Contador:", contador)
    contador += 1
    

Exemplo 2 (Loop for):

frutas = ["maçã", "banana", "laranja"]
for fruta in frutas:
    print("Eu gosto de", fruta)
	

Dicas para Utilizar Loops em Python

  1. Escolha o tipo de loop adequado
  2. Utilize variáveis de controle
  3. Evite loops infinitos
  4. Otimize seu código
  5. Faça uso de bibliotecas e funções built-in

Dicas Avançadas para Dominar Loops em Python

Aprender a dominar loops em Python é apenas o começo. Existem algumas técnicas avançadas que podem ajudá-lo a melhorar suas habilidades de programação e tornar seus algoritmos mais eficientes. Vamos explorar algumas dicas avançadas para dominar loops em Python:

  1. Utilize compreensão de listas
  2. Aproveite os geradores
  3. Explore as funções map, filter e reduce
  4. Utilize decoradores

Exemplos Práticos de Loops em Python

A melhor maneira de aperfeiçoar suas habilidades de programação em relação aos loops em Python é através da prática. Vamos explorar alguns exemplos práticos de loops em Python que podem ajudá-lo a consolidar seus conhecimentos:

1. Calcular a soma dos números de 1 a 100:
soma = 0
for i in range(1, 101):
    soma += i
print("A soma dos números de 1 a 100 é:", soma)

2. Encontrar os números pares em uma lista:
numeros = [1, 2, 3, 4, 5, 6, 7, 8, 9, 10]
pares = []
for numero in numeros:
    if numero % 2 == 0:
        pares.append(numero)
print("Os números pares são:", pares)

3. Imprimir os caracteres de uma string em ordem inversa:
texto = "Python é incrível!"
for caracter in texto[::-1]:
    print(caracter)

4. Verificar se uma palavra é um palíndromo:
palavra = "arara"
palindromo = True
for i in range(len(palavra)):
    if palavra[i] != palavra[-1-i]:
        palindromo = False
        break
if palindromo:
    print("A palavra é um palíndromo.")
else:
    print("A palavra não é um palíndromo.")

Aprenda com a Awari

A Awari é a melhor plataforma para aprender sobre programação no Brasil. Aqui você encontra cursos com aulas ao vivo, mentorias individuais com os melhores profissionais do mercado e suporte de carreira personalizado para dar seu próximo passo profissional e aprender habilidades como Data Science, Data Analytics, Machine Learning e mais.

Já pensou em aprender de maneira individualizada com profissionais que atuam em empresas como Nubank, Amazon e Google? Clique aqui para se inscrever na Awari e começar a construir agora mesmo o próximo capítulo da sua carreira em dados.

Conclusão

Aprenda a dominar loops em Python e eleve suas habilidades de programação. Com dedicação, prática e aplicação das técnicas apresentadas neste artigo, você estará preparado para criar algoritmos poderosos e soluções eficientes para os mais diversos problemas. Não deixe de explorar a documentação oficial do Python e buscar por novos desafios para aprimorar ainda mais suas habilidades.


🔥 Intensivão de inglês na Fluency!

Nome*
Ex.: João Santos
E-mail*
Ex.: email@dominio.com
Telefone*
somente números

Próximos conteúdos

🔥 Intensivão de inglês na Fluency!

Nome*
Ex.: João Santos
E-mail*
Ex.: email@dominio.com
Telefone*
somente números

🔥 Intensivão de inglês na Fluency!

Nome*
Ex.: João Santos
E-mail*
Ex.: email@dominio.com
Telefone*
somente números

🔥 Intensivão de inglês na Fluency!

Nome*
Ex.: João Santos
E-mail*
Ex.: email@dominio.com
Telefone*
somente números
inscreva-se

Entre para a próxima turma com bônus exclusivos

Faça parte da maior escola de idiomas do mundo com os professores mais amados da internet.

Curso completo do básico ao avançado
Aplicativo de memorização para lembrar de tudo que aprendeu
Aulas de conversação para destravar um novo idioma
Certificado reconhecido no mercado
Nome*
Ex.: João Santos
E-mail*
Ex.: email@dominio.com
Telefone*
somente números
Empresa
Ex.: Fluency Academy
Ao clicar no botão “Solicitar Proposta”, você concorda com os nossos Termos de Uso e Política de Privacidade.